Hendersonville, Tennessee Auto Glass Repair Costs

Typical Hendersonville-area pricing, estimated from national installer data and adjusted for Tennessee labor and parts rates. Your exact quote depends on the vehicle, glass features, and whether ADAS recalibration is required.

ServiceLowTypicalHigh
Windshield Replacement$210$325$440
Windshield Replacement + ADAS Calibration$440$595$960
Rock Chip Repair$55$85$135
Side Window Replacement$155$225$390
Rear Window Replacement$175$290$565

Common Auto Glass Services in Hendersonville

Windshield Replacement

Full glass swap when cracks exceed repairable size. Hendersonville shops carry OEM and OEM-equivalent options for most makes.

Rock Chip Repair

Resin injection in 20–30 minutes. Stops the crack, often free with comprehensive insurance for Tennessee drivers.

Mobile Auto Glass Service

Most Hendersonville shops dispatch a tech to your home, office, or job site — no driving on a cracked windshield.

ADAS Calibration

Required after windshield replacement on most 2018+ vehicles for lane departure, automatic braking, and adaptive cruise.

Insurance Claim Help

Direct billing, deductible verification, and paperwork handled by the shop. Many Tennessee drivers pay zero out-of-pocket.

Side & Rear Glass

Door glass, quarter windows, rear windshields with defroster reconnection — same-day availability at most Hendersonville shops.

Hendersonville Auto Glass — Frequently Asked Questions

How much does windshield replacement cost in Hendersonville, Tennessee?

In Hendersonville, a standard windshield replacement typically runs $210–$440, with most drivers paying around $325. Vehicles from 2018 and newer that need ADAS camera recalibration usually land between $440 and $960. A rock chip repair is far cheaper — about $55–$135, and often free with comprehensive insurance.

How much does it cost to replace a side window in Hendersonville?

Side window (door glass) replacement in the Hendersonville area generally costs $155–$390, averaging around $225. Frameless or laminated door glass on newer vehicles sits at the top of that range. Most Hendersonville shops vacuum out broken glass and can complete the job the same day.

How much does rear window replacement cost in Hendersonville?

Rear windshield replacement for Hendersonville, Tennessee drivers typically runs $175–$565, with an average around $290 — the defroster grid and any embedded antenna are what push the price up. Shops reconnect the defroster as part of the install.

Do auto glass shops in Hendersonville offer mobile service?

Yes. Most Hendersonville auto glass shops dispatch a mobile technician to your home, office, or job site at no extra charge, so you never have to drive on a cracked windshield. Same-day mobile appointments are common throughout the Hendersonville area.

Will my insurance cover windshield repair in Tennessee?

If you carry comprehensive coverage, windshield repair is usually covered and many Tennessee policies waive the deductible for chip repairs. Full replacements are covered too, though your deductible may apply. Hendersonville shops handle the paperwork and bill your carrier directly.

How long does a windshield replacement take in Hendersonville?

The replacement itself takes about an hour, plus a safe-drive-away time of roughly one hour for the adhesive to cure. If your vehicle needs ADAS calibration, add another 30–60 minutes. Most Hendersonville shops have you back on the road the same day.
